About Color #686331 (#686331)
#686331 is a yellow color (colour) with RGB channel values of 104 red, 99 green, and 49 blue. The red channel is dominant by a ratio of 2.1:1 over the weakest channel. In HSL terms, the hue sits at 55 degrees with 36% saturation and 30% lightness, placing it in the warm range of the colour spectrum.
The perceived brightness of #686331 is 95/255 using the ITU-R BT.601 luma formula (0.299R + 0.587G + 0.114B). This appears dark to the human eye, so pair it with light text for adequate readability. For print production, the CMYK equivalent is 0% cyan, 5% magenta, 53% yellow, and 59% key (black).
The WCAG contrast ratio of #686331 against white is 6.14:1 and against black is 3.42:1. This meets the AA requirement (4.5:1) for normal text on white. For AAA compliance, consider darkening to at least 21% lightness.
The complementary colour #313668 creates maximum visual tension when paired with #686331. For more harmonious color combinations, use the analogous colours #684831 and #516831, which sit 30 degrees on either side of the hue wheel.
